Ingredients Breakdown

Here’s what you’ll need for this delicious oven-roasted BBQ salmon:

  • 4 (6 oz) filets of salmon (boneless and skinless): Choose high-quality salmon for the best flavor.
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il (or neutral oil): This helps the spice rub adhere to the fish and adds moisture.
  • 2 tablespoons smoked paprika: Provides a rich, smoky flavor that complements the sweetness of the brown sugar.
  • 2 tablespoons packed brown sugar: Balances the spices and caramelizes beautifully during cooking.
  • 1 tablespoon ground cumin: Adds warmth and depth to the flavor profile.
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der: Enhances the overall savory notes of the dish.
  • 1 teaspoon onion powder: Complements the garlic and adds an aromatic quality.
  • 2 teaspoons kosher salt: Essential for bringing out the flavors of the salmon.

  • Step 1: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Line a baking tray with parchment paper to prevent sticking.
  • Step 2: Place the salmon filets skin-side down on the baking tray.
  • Step 3: In a small bowl, whisk together all of the BBQ spice rub ingredients until fully combined.
  • Step 4: Brush the salmon with a thin layer of olive oil, then generously coat it on all sides with the spice rub.
  • Step 5: Bake for 12 minutes, then broil for an additional 2-3 minutes, or until the fish is cooked through and slightly charred. Serve warm or at room temperature.

Common Mistakes and Troubleshooting

Even the best recipes can have hiccups. Here are some common mistakes and how to avoid them:

  • Overcooking: Keep an eye on the time, as salmon can become dry if left too long in the oven.
  • Uneven Cooking: Make sure your salmon is of even thickness for consistent cooking throughout.
  • Flavorless Fish: Don’t skimp on the spice rub! Generously coating the fish ensures a flavorful crust.
  • Sticking to the Pan: Using parchment paper or a silicone baking mat can prevent sticking and make cleanup easier.

Storage and Make-Ahead Instructions

Planning ahead can make weeknight dinners a breeze:

  • Storing Leftovers: Keep any leftover salmon in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days.
  • Freezing: You can freeze cooked salmon for up to three months. Just ensure it’s wrapped tightly to avoid freezer burn.
  • Make-Ahead: Prepare the spice rub in advance and store it in an airtight container for quick access during cooking.

Comprehensive FAQ

Here are some frequently asked questions to help you along your culinary journey:

  • Can I use skin-on salmon? Yes, but keep in mind that the skin will not crisp up in the oven.
  • What is the best way to know when salmon is done? The salmon is cooked when it flakes easily with a fork and is opaque in the center.
  • Can I substitute other fish? Yes, you can use other firm fish like trout or cod, but cooking times may vary.
  • What should I serve with BBQ salmon? This dish pairs well with steamed vegetables, rice, or a fresh salad.
  • How do I reheat leftover salmon? Gently reheat in the oven at a low temperature or in the microwave for a few seconds.
  • Is this recipe gluten-free? Yes, all ingredients used are gluten-free. Just be sure to verify any packaged components.
  • Can I marinate the salmon? Absolutely! Marinating for 30 minutes to an hour can enhance the flavors even more.
  • How long does it take to cook salmon in the oven? Typically, 12-15 minutes at 375°F works well, depending on the thickness of the fillets.
